What is an Industrial Model?
An industrial model is a detailed and scaled representation of industrial structures, machinery, or entire production facilities. Unlike architectural models, which primarily focus on buildings and urban layouts, industrial models emphasize functional elements, production processes, and equipment layout. They allow stakeholders to understand complex industrial systems, identify potential inefficiencies, and make informed decisions about design, construction, and operational workflow.
Industrial models are widely used in various sectors including manufacturing, energy, automotive, aerospace, and heavy machinery. They serve multiple purposes: from presenting a client’s vision to investors, to aiding engineers in planning assembly lines, and even training employees on machinery operation in a risk-free environment.
The Importance of Industrial Models
The process of creating industrial models is far from mere aesthetics; it is a functional tool that can save companies time, money, and resources. By using a model, engineers can test the feasibility of a layout or design before committing to full-scale production. Mistakes at this stage are less costly compared to errors discovered during actual manufacturing or construction. Models also facilitate communication between departments, helping managers, engineers, designers, and clients align their understanding and expectations.
Moreover, industrial models serve as powerful marketing and presentation tools. For potential investors or stakeholders, a highly detailed and precise model communicates professionalism, foresight, and technical competence. It allows them to see the end product and understand its scope and impact, often making complex industrial projects more tangible and comprehensible.
Types of Industrial Models
Industrial models can vary significantly depending on the purpose, scale, and complexity of the project. Some of the common types include:
Functional Models – These are operational models designed to demonstrate the working mechanics of a system or machinery. They are particularly valuable for technical testing and educational purposes.
Scale Models – Scale models represent large industrial setups, such as factories, processing plants, or assembly lines, in a smaller, more manageable format. This type helps with spatial planning, workflow optimization, and structural analysis.
Prototype Models – Used primarily during the development phase of new machinery or technology, prototype models allow engineers to test and refine their designs before full-scale production.
Conceptual Models – These models are less focused on operational functionality and more on visual representation. They are ideal for presentations and strategic planning.
Digital Models – While not physical, digital 3D models are increasingly used in combination with traditional models to provide virtual simulations, offering dynamic insights into industrial processes.

Future Trends in Industrial Modeling
The field of industrial modeling is evolving rapidly. Technological advancements such as virtual reality (VR), augmented reality (AR), and digital twins are transforming how industrial models are used. VR and AR allow stakeholders to immerse themselves in a model digitally, exploring layouts and machinery in a fully interactive environment. Digital twins provide real-time simulations, linking the model to actual machinery and operations, enabling predictive analysis and optimization.
Despite these technological advances, physical industrial models remain invaluable. They provide tactile feedback, scale perception, and a visual impact that digital models cannot fully replicate.
